

A celebration of life graveside service will be held at the Beaufort National Cemetery in Beaufort, South Carolina. A tribute to an honorable life well lived will be given by all the family and friends who attend.
Mrs. Crutchfield was a native of Washington, D.C. She was a devoted wife to her husband of Forty-Seven years and relocated throughout the United States during her Husband’s career in the United States Marine Corp. However, she had resided in Saint Simons Island for the last several years since her and her husband’s retirement. She was the daughter of the late William A. and Loretta Ruth. Mrs. Crutchfield was a retired secretary with Saint Vincent DePaul Society. She enjoyed spending time with her family and cherished every moment spent with her grandchildren.
Mrs. Crutchfield is survived by her loving husband, 1st Sgt. Jerry D. Crutchfield; a daughter, Chere Garner “Steve” of Saint Simons Island, Georgia; a son, Captain Colt Crutchfield of Fort Campbell Kentucky; two granddaughters, Alexis and Avery Garner; one grandson, Sam Garner. Several nieces and nephews also survive.
She will be greatly missed by all who knew and loved her. However, her family will have many treasured memories to cherish forever.
